Transaction c1e24c7cdb50d11de764d8ecd949891555e2ff76b879b1a363ae83b01a671d58

block
86f2197ee1140bd4c16ff0175cf96210376ce71f2071e2b2a40a07417761ad9f

1 Input

28 Outputs